The Wills Eye Institute 5Minute Ophthalmology Consult provides a readily accessible and focused compendium of ophthalmic abnormalities that will be useful for students, physicians and ancillary medical staff. Evidencebased references are included and algorithmic flow diagrams are provided for rapid problem solving. In keeping with the very successful 5Minute Clinical Consult brand, over 330 topics will be covered, each in a highly formatted 2page spread.
